The Miami Beach Convention Center District started in 2009 when West 8 was asked to design the Soundscape Park of the New World Symphony Building. Before, the unifying character was the grey, hot tarmac of the parking lots. Today, the entire district is a system of interconnected, welcoming and green urban spaces. Soundscape park is a unique site with one important philanthropic component: Allowing people who can not afford a symphony ticket to experience the area's beauty via top-of-the-line projections onto the building's exterior. This urban oasis reflects the identity of the New World Symphony while tieing back to the legacy and culture of Miami. 

 

Following the success of Soundscape Park, West 8 was asked to join the team to upgrade the entire district around the Convention Center. Together with Fentress Architects, they executed a cohesive masterplan to integrate the creative vision for the district with the function of the convention center, while keeping in mind the importance of streetscapes and connectivity throughout a public space.

About Daniel Vasini and West 8:

Daniel Vasini is the Creative Director of West 8. Vasini leads and collaborates with top-tier multi-disciplinary teams that address complex challenges and envision solutions for the major urban design issues of our time. Daniel specializes in transformative urban waterfront projects, and creates master plans, urban designs, and large-scale landscape architecture interventions. 

West 8 is an urban planning and landscape architecture firm founded by Adriaan Geuze and Paul van Beek in Amsterdam, the Netherlands in 1987. With offices in Rotterdam, the Netherlands and Philadelphia, PA, the firm has established itself with an international team of 70 architects, urban designers, landscape architects and industrial engineers over the past 35 years.
